I chose Plum Island on Saturday morning, and wasn't out really early after a hard week (and finally having adjusted the 6 hour time zone difference, probably even overadjusted ;-), but the weather was so enticing, I stayed for hours even after there wasn't any good photo light having the harsh sun out at full strength.

Birds seen included next to a Great Egret some first times for me European: a Northern Mockingbird, some red-winged Blackbirds, and a whole tree full of Tree Swallows, to my delight - couldn't help but fell in love with them at once.
